Abstract
Hydrogen peroxide can be used to promote the cell growth in the wound healing process if the concentration is ideal for the cell. In this research, the determination of half maximal inhibitory concentration of hydrogen peroxide in CRL-2522 fibroblast skin is conducted through MTT assay method. The CRL-2522 was cultured in a favourable media before proceed with the MTT assay. The positive control was treated with media while negative control was treated with 5% concentration of hydrogen peroxide. The hydrogen peroxide was diluted into a various concentration, such as 0.3%, 1 %, 1.25%, 2.3% and 3%. After the cell confluent in the 96-well plate, the different concentration of hydrogen peroxide was used as a treatment in each wells. In conclusion, hydrogen peroxide had a value of IC50 which is above 3% of the concentration.
